Green Vegetarian Sandwiches

  • 1 hamburger bun (GREEN, homemade with spirulina)
  • 1 oz gorgonzola
  • 4 pistachios
  • 1.75 oz white onions
  • 1 drizzle extra virgin olive oil (or peanut oil)
  • to taste salt (and preferred spices)

Tools

  • Frying Pan non-stick
  • Ladle
  • Cutting Board and knife

Green Vegetarian Sandwiches

  • Prepare the onions

    Peel the onion, quickly wash it and slice it.

    In a suitably sized pot, pour the oil, the onion, salt, and preferred herbs. Cook and stir as needed for 10 – 15 minutes or until the liquid is absorbed.

    Fill the green burger bun

    Cut the bun in half.

    Fill with:

    – a layer of gorgonzola

    – the sautéed onions

    – chopped pistachios (or roughly chopped)

FILLING IDEAS for vegetarian sandwiches

Vegetable burger, mayonnaise, and tomatoes

– lettuce leaves or arugula

vegetable burger

– mayonnaise

– tomato slices

Pickles, burger, ketchup

– sweet and sour pickles in slices

vegetarian burger

– ketchup (or mayonnaise)

Mushrooms, pumpkin, and cheese:

Mushrooms and pumpkin cooked in a pan

– stracchino (or cheese slices)

Hummus and sautéed vegetables – VEGAN recipe

– hummus (or lupin cream)

sautéed vegetables with soy sauce

Peppers and eggs:

– roasted pepper strips, peeled

– omelet (or sunny-side-up egg)

tzatziki sauce (or plain Greek yogurt with herbs, salt, and oil)

Pesto, tomato, and ricotta

– pesto (zucchini)

– tomato slices (or cherry tomatoes halved)

– ricotta (or crescenza)

Red radicchio, mozzarella, and walnuts

red radicchio cooked in a pan

– mozzarella (Buffalo)

– walnut kernels (or other nuts)

Grilled vegetables and chickpea pancake

grilled vegetables

chickpea pancake

– salad (or arugula)

Zucchini, guacamole, and eggs

grilled zucchini

guacamole

– fried eggs (or sliced hard-boiled eggs)

STORAGE of green vegetarian sandwiches

Once the vegetarian burger sandwiches are ready:

– enjoy immediately

– store in the fridge wrapped in plastic wrap for up to 2 days; before consuming, slightly warm them in the oven
